Hi, i bricked my wii when launching for the first time the backup game donkey kong in the usbloader gx R938 i think. and it instantly crashed with a black screen. then i turn off-->on the wii, and ever black screen.

i have a 2008 PAL WII.
4.1 E
softmodded and wiikey-v1 chip
homebrew channel and priiloader
hermes 222 ...
i don't have the bootmii as boot2, only as ios.
green light.

the priiloader doesn't work, and i tried the savemiifrii but it doesn't work.

what can i do?

Unfortunatly, I think you have fully bricked you wii, probably from some bug in USBloader GX, cios, or the game itself. From your post, I think your only option would be to send the wii out for nand reprogramming. Nand reprogramming will only work if you have your nand keys from bootmii backup or other method, or you wii is old enough to support boot2 bootmii. Deadlyfoez, Bad-Ad84, Streamlinehd can all reprogram your nand for you. Send your wii out for reprogramming if you can.

There isn't a good understanding of why this is happening, but Mauifrog and a few others have seen several cases. Since an update to USB Loader GX hasn't been pushed in some time, I'm guessing it's a strange interaction between it and the newer versions of cIOS. The problem doesn't appear to be game-specific; the only common thread is USBLGX and presumably cIOS. It's a shame really, as USBLGX was my favorite loader for quite some time.

Things like this are probably one of the reasons TT has pushed for AHBPROT support instead of IOS patches and cIOS.

I have no idea how it could happen, but when you run these apps they have full potential to corrupt the nand from some bug. Any app has to potential of fully bricking your wii from some unforeseen bug.


@OP
You should probably verify that you bluetooth module is working. Can you power you wii on with the wiimote? If not it is also possible that you bluetooth module is dead. You can further test with savemiifrii to see if your recovery menu is functional, which it would be if the module was bad.
